I don't work for these guys, I am just a really happy subscriber. For the past year I've subscribed to
Paste Magazine and I find it to be a fantastic mag. I only found out about it through a link on somebody's blog - otherwise I never would have known about it at all.
It comes out six times a year and features excellent, really well thought-out articles on bands like Wilco, The Roots, Los Lobos, and solo artists like Pete Yorn, Sarah McLachlan, Patty Griffin, Aimee Mann and a boatload of others. In addition, they also have tons of excellent CD, movie and book reviews...although the majority of the reviews are of CDs, movies and books I've never heard of before - which is really cool.
The best part of the magazine is the CD that comes with every issue - it has around 20 tracks from many of the artists, both major and indie, reviewed or written about in the magazine. I haven't had a chance to check it out yet, but my most recent issue came with both a CD and a DVD - which is also really awesome. The only downside to the whole thing is the cost - $26.95 for six issues over the year - but I imagine that's partially because of the CD inclusion and partially because it's a very small company.
